Use the following passage to answer questions: Mitochondria are thought to play a key regulatory role in the development of neurodegenerative disease and other age-related pathology. The organelle is the main source of ATP for the cell and is also involved in numerous processes, including phospholipid biosynthesis and calcium signaling. However, the process that forms ATP, termed oxidative phosphorylation, requires the transfer of electrons from food-derived molecules to oxygen and results in the production of reactive oxygen species (ROS).
